Investigating the Relationship Between Gait, Depression, and Mind-body Therapy in Seniors

Falls are the leading cause of injury--‐related hospitalization and death in the elderly. As such, fear of falling (FOF) is common among senior populations and often leads to activity avoidance, social isolation, and reduced physical and mental health. Risk of falls is particularly concerning for individuals suffering from late life depression (LLD) as both depression and antidepressant treatment have been shown to be linked to gait impairments, a strong predictor of fall risk. Currently, our team is conducting a study to examine the effects of a non--‐pharmacological mind--‐body therapy commonly known as automatic self--‐transcending meditation (ASTM) on autonomic and mood--‐related symptoms of LLD. This study provides a timely opportunity to explore the intricate relationship between gait disturbances and depression severity, as well as the potential benefits of ASTM intervention on gait and FOF in seniors. Using a GAITRite® portable walkway, measures of stride length and gait velocity will be obtained for seniors in the ASTM and control study arms every four weeks for the duration of the ASTM program. The aim of this study is to answer the following research questions: are gait impairments and depression severity correlated, and does ASTM training have any effect on gait and FOF? The results of this study could not only provide insight into the physical manifestations of depression but if ASTM training is found to improve gait and reduce FOF then there is potential to use this mind--‐body meditation technique as an adjunct therapy to reduce fall risk in seniors with LLD. Furthermore, future research could expand upon these findings to examine the benefits of ASTM on gait impairments secondary to other psychiatric illnesses.

Inclusion Criteria: - participants must be at least 65 years of age - have a diagnosis of mild to moderate MDD with a 17 item Hamilton Depression Rating Scale (HAMD-17) score of 8 to 22 - be of good general physical health - have sufficient hearing to be able to follow verbal instructions - be able to sit without physical discomfort for 45 minutes and be able to attend 4 initial ASTM training sessions. They must also agree to home practice of ASTM and to attend 75% of weekly follow-up sessions. Exclusion Criteria: - potential participants must also be free of any physical impairments that would cause discomfort/stress when walking or affect our ability to obtain a representative measure of gait including injuries of the spinal cord, leg or foot, muscular dystrophy, multiple sclerosis, spinal stenosis, scoliosis, spondylolithesis, and severe osteoarthritis or rheumatoid arthritis of the spine. |
